What did Woodrow Wilson hope his Fourteen Points would accomplish?
Yanka [14]
<span> He wanted to create a 'League of Nations' which would be a coalition of many nations (Germany was banned from being a part of it since they were blamed for causing WW1) that would help to prevent any future wars. This was Wilson's main goal. However, since there was a lot of partisan feeling, and being involved in the League would take away the power that Congress had to declare war, Congress ended up voting against joining the League. </span>
